    Yeah I nabbed a couple out of 7g's, but the 2g eclipse, is the same as mentioned above.

    The top button takes place of the release button on your stock shifter. The side is for o/d, but we don't have it in the 8g. The toggle has 3 wires coming out of it... I haven't had the chance to look into it much more yet.

    Ok guys. For those of you that know I had problems with my HID fogs. It turns out like you said I didn't need a relay. My friend figured it out because one ballast was bad and the connection included with the HIDs weren't full hence no light because of no connectivity. We spent a while putting them in and here they are
